    We are considering a Disney Alaska cruise in June-July, 2027. Our grandsons are very interested in whales. Which cruises and Port Adventures will give them the best opportunity to observe these marine mammals?

    I did some Disney Cruise Line research and found that the three Alaskan Ports of Call offering the best whale watching adventures are Icy Strait Point, Juneau, and Sitka, with Icy Strait Point rumored to be the best place for whale watching in the state. 

    My recommendation is to book a cruise that visits one or more of these ports, to give your grandsons the highest chance of seeing those majestic mammals. I found multiple Disney cruises that sail to at least one during the time period you’re asking about. I also found an 8-Night Alaskan cruise on the Disney Magic that sails to both Icy Strait Point and Sitka on July 22-July 30, 2027.

    As for the whale-associated Port Adventures, they vary by age range in each port. While I don’t know your grandsons' ages, I did find a few for different age groups in each Port of Call, with Juneau having the highest number of options, followed by Icy Strait Point. To easily find them, on the Alaska Port Adventures page, you can filter by Port of Call, and then “Nature, Sightseeing” to narrow them down even further to the whale activity ones. 

    I don’t think you can go wrong with any of them, as each will offer your whale-loving grandsons a memorable adventure. But if you're wondering which ones I have my own whale-loving sights on, it's the "Whale and Marine Mammals Cruise (IS01)" in Icy Strait Point, offering whale watching and marine life sightings like adorable sea otters; as well as "Alaska Whales and Rainforest Trails (JU34)" in Juneau, offering views of orcas and humpback whales. When booking, please remember that while marine life sightings are common for this time of year, they are never guaranteed.
